Opposite the green on the main street of Elvington, The Grey Horse is a picture-postcard village inn dating back to the 17th century. Window boxes adorn the whitewashed frontage, and picnic tables are set outside in the summer.

The interior is equally charming, with a wealth of wood, subtle lighting and plenty of cosy seating enhancing the welcoming ambience. Upstairs, the Hayloft, with its warm yellow walls, watercolours and palewood furniture, provides a bright, stylish venue for functions and special occasions. The abundance of memorabilia on display throughout includes old photographs of village life.

Run by David Forster and Jason Butler, the inn, winner of a CAMRA (Yorkshire Branch) Country Pub of the Year Award and regional winner of The Pub Shine awards for drinking experience, serves up to five real ales (Theakstons, John Smith, Timothy Taylor Landlord and two guests) together with a good range of other beers and stouts, lagers, wines, spirits and non-alcoholic drinks. The Grey Horse is also a great place for a meal, and the regular menu and specials board offers a wide and tempting choice.

The inn lies just six miles southeast of York on the B1228, and for visitors exploring this marvellous city the Grey Horse provides a pleasant and convenient base in two en suite bedrooms - a double and a family room - with superb comfort and full facilities. Even closer, just over a mile away, is one of the most interesting museums in the whole region - the Yorkshire Air Museum, with its unique collection of over 40 aircraft and numerous displays, located on one of the very few original wartime bomber bases open to the public.
